Festival Details
The festival will be held on Saturday, October 4, 2025, from 9:00 AM to 4:00 PM in Downtown Aubrey, TX 76227. Admission is free, making it accessible for all visitors. This event is perfect for families, friends, and community members looking to enjoy a fun-filled day outdoors.
- Date: Saturday, October 4, 2025
- Time: 9:00 AM – 4:00 PM
- Location: Downtown Aubrey, TX 76227
- Admission: Free
Activities and Attractions

The festival offers a variety of attractions and entertainment suitable for all ages. Visitors can enjoy a mix of traditional and modern festival activities designed to engage the whole family.
- Parade: The annual parade kicks off at 10:00 AM, featuring local floats, marching bands, and community groups
- Live Music: Performances by artists like Zach Wilkerson and Matt Hillyer at the Lennar Stage and Veterans Memorial Stage throughout the day
- Kid Zone: Free area with face painting, pony rides, train rides, bounce houses, and a petting zoo
- Vendors: Over 150 booths offering crafts, apparel, baked goods, jewelry, and more
- Food Trucks: A variety of food trucks serving a wide range of delicious options
Parking and Accessibility
The festival provides ample parking options to make attending easy and convenient. Visitors are encouraged to plan their arrival to avoid delays.
- Main Parking Lot: Located at 418 N Magnolia St with free shuttle service
- Additional Parking: Available off Bluebonnet St., Caddell St., S. Main St., W. Pecan St., S. Magnolia St. near E. Elm St., and at First Rock Fellowship Church
- Handicap Parking: Designated spaces off Plum St. near S. Magnolia St.
